A medical alert system in Dublin can provide numerous elderly and handicapped people with the ability to survive on their own, and exercise a high degree of independence. Here’s what you have to know prior to signing up with a medical alert system service provider.

Technically, an alert system is typically consisted of a wrist band transmitter– looking like a wrist watch– or a necklace-type transmitter that is worn at all times. If the individual should have a medical problem or mishap, they can merely push a button on the used transmitter to interact with the medical alert tracking.

This assists the monitoring center expert to much better encourage you in case of a medical emergency, and they might likewise send out emergency medical assistance if needed. Optionally, the monitoring center can be instructed to also contact one or more of your loved ones whenever the help button is pressed.The price of a medical alert system can differ inning accordance with the level of service you need, however in general they are a really reasonably-priced option to helped living centers.

Medical Alert Systems with Fall Detection

The very best Medical alert systems have come a long way in the last 5 years. Today’s advanced systems can identify when a user has actually fallen instantly. It’s all in the advanced algorithms established by brilliant engineers and ingrained into small gadgets which are saving lives daily. These smart-systems can distinguish (in many cases) between when someone has in fact fallen, when someone has actually chosen to sit down abruptly.

Emergency Buttons and Medical Alert button in 94568

Panic Buttons for the senior are available in lots of choices and with numerous functions. Essentially a panic button is an emergency button which can be pressed in case of an emergency, whether it be a fall, or cardiac arrest. These panic buttons can be used around the neck or as a bracelet.

Panic buttons can be one way or 2-way. A one method panic button for the senior will work in one method just. The person in distress presses a button, which sends a signal. Generally this will place an emergency call to the numbers currently configured into the system.

Some business enable 9 numbers to be programmed. Each of these 9 numbers will be called one after the other till a human is reached. In case you are questioning how a machine understands that a human has lifted the phone, then here is how it works. When an individual takes the call, he is asked to enter in a number. If the number is entered properly, then the system presumes that it is a live individual and not an answering machine. Then the system will play the message for the person raising the call.

In a 2-way system, a 2-way interaction is established in between the person in distress and the emergency alert company. This is why it is essential you select a reputable company. It is well worth the few additional dollars spent monthly, in return for quality service and action.

Some 2-way service providers will offer extra service. Some alarm business will pull up medical records of the patient to identify if he has any recognized medical problems. This guarantees immediate service and can prevent a lot of hassle and frustration.

Panic buttons for the senior can be used as a bracelet, pendant or on the belt. They are generally water proof so there is no problems with the emergency alert systems getting ruined due to moisture.

Senior Alert Systems and Medical Alert Devices FAQ

    1. Do You want a Home-Based or Mobile System?

Initially, medical alert systems were created to work inside your house, with your landline telephone.

And you can still go that route. Many business likewise now provide the option of home-based systems that work over a cellular network, for those who may not have a landline.

With these systems, pressing the wearable call button permits you to speak with a dispatcher through a base unit located in your house.

Numerous companies provide mobile choices, too. You can utilize these systems in the house, however they’ll likewise permit you to call for help while you’re out and about.

These run over cellular networks and integrate GPS innovation. By doing this, if you get lost or push the call button for assistance but are unable to talk, the monitoring service can locate you.

    1. Should You Add a Fall-Detection Feature?

Some companies offer the option of automatic fall detection, for an additional monthly fee. Manufacturers say these devices sense falls when they occur and automatically contact the dispatch center, just as they would if you had pressed the call button.

    1. Whats the Cost?

Fees. Beware of complicated pricing plans and hidden fees. Look for a company with no extra fees related to equipment, shipping, installation, activation, or service and repair. Don’t fall for scams that offer free service or “donated or used” equipment.
Contracts. You should not have to enter into a long-term contract. You should only have to pay ongoing monthly fees, which should range between $25 and $45 a month (about $1 a day). Be careful about paying for service in advance, since you never know when you’ll need to stop the service temporarily (due to a hospitalization, for instance) or permanently.
Guarantee and cancellation policies. Look for a full money-back guarantee, or at least a trial period, in case you are not satisfied with the service. And you’ll want the ability to cancel at any time with no penalties (and a full refund if monthly fees have already been paid).
Discounts. Ask about discounts for multiple people in the same household, as well as for veterans, membership organizations, medical insurance or via a hospital, medical or care organization. Ask if the company offers any discount options or a sliding fee scale for people with lower incomes.
Insurance. For the most part, Medicare and private insurance companies will not cover the costs of a medical alert. In some states Medicaid may cover all or part of the cost. You can check with your private insurance company to see if it offers discounts or referrals.
Tax deductions. Check with your tax professional to find out if the cost of a medical alert is tax deductible as a medically necessary expense.

Life Alert

Life Alert is one of the best known medical alert systems on the market today. They are famous for the “I’ve fallen and can’t get up” TV commercials. They have two major product lines; Life Alert 50+ and Life Alert Classic.

The good:

Life Alert is built around medical alert monitoring and do not have any other product lines. They have been a player in the industry for years and have built one of the best offerings available. They offer several features such as fire, carbon monoxide, and fall monitoring. There is installation service available. They also offer a refund if the user dies alone in their home.

The bad:

The monthly costs are much higher than other services. This is due one of the largest and best known companies in the industry. Purchasing medical alert system is difficult and sales reps seemed to give differing information on each call. They have 24 hour monitoring but customer service is only available during business hours. They require a 3 year contract, which is much longer than any competitor. Additional options are expensive to add and increase monthly fees. They do not have activity monitoring or automated system testing. While they have many features, there is no fall monitor option available.

  • Dublin, California

    Dublin (formerly, Amador and Dougherty's Station) is a suburban city of the East (San Francisco) Bay and Tri-Valley regions of Alameda County, California, United States. Located along the north side of Interstate 580 at the intersection with Interstate 680, roughly 35 miles (56 km) east of downtown San Francisco, 23 miles (37 km) east of downtown Oakland, and 31 miles (50 km) north of downtown San Jose, it was referred to as "Dublin" in reference to the city of Dublin in Ireland because of the large number of Irish who lived there.[9] The post office formally adopted the name in the 1890s.[9]

    Dublin is the second fastest-growing city in the state of California, behind only Santa Clarita.[10] The population was 46,063 (2010 census), and the 2013 estimate at 49,890. Dublin was formerly home to the headquarters of Sybase, Inc (now part of SAP SE) and is currently home to the headquarters CallidusCloud, Ross Stores, Tria Beauty,[11] Medley Health,[12] Challenge Dairy and Arlen Ness.

    The City of Dublin is a general law city operating under a City Council / City Manager form of local government. This form of government combines an elected mayor and council and an appointed local government administrator. The City Council elections are nonpartisan. The Mayor serves a two-year term, and Council members serve four-year terms.
